Full Job Description
Position Description:

We are seeking an experienced Construction Lead to join our construction team and provide leadership for our Southern Region operations while collaborating with construction leaders across other regions. The ideal candidate will bring a minimum of 10 years of experience in water and wastewater facilites/utilites, construction engineering, and construction management experience. Candidates must possess a Bachelor's degree in Civil Engineering and a Professional Engineer (PE) license. This role requires strong leadership, technical expertise, and the ability to foster collaboration across regional teams to support strategic growth and project success.
